On Tuesday 29 Mar 2005 08:29, Mikkel L. Ellertson wrote: > Rosemary McGillicuddy wrote: > > Yesterday I noticed I could not access packages on CD1 while in konsole > > doing urpmi. This is a new problem. I put the CD in, heard the > > whirring, but as soon as I pressed 'enter' it stopped. Didn't get any > > message I think. > > > > In Konqueror - attempted to mount a CD to look at photos (which I've been > > able to do previously). > > The message I get is: > > "mount: mount point /mnt/cdrom does not exist. Please check that the > > disk is entered correctly. The file or folder /mnt/cdrom does not > > exist." > > > > This may relate to the other problems I am having. > > > > Rosemary > > Easy fix. As root, run "mkdir /mnt/cdrom". All will be good. > > I broke this when I had you change how /dev/hda6 got mounted. It may > have broke a couple of other things. The reasion is that the mount > points for other things must have been created after hda6 was mounted on > /mnt. With /dev/hda6 no longer mounted there, then mount point is missing. > > Mikkel
